Harrow

Operating in Harrow flexible office positions your business in a borough undergoing major renewal, backed by an £8.2 million town centre funding package. The redevelopment project will deliver a more contemporary commercial environment, featuring upgraded public spaces and new amenities. Additionally, the enhanced connectivity provided by the Superloop express network, which links Harrow to Heathrow, will ensure more efficient travel for both clients and teams.

Harrow's attractiveness is significantly boosted by its strong commercial draw, which generates consistent footfall from neighbouring northwest London areas. A diverse range of employers ensures a reliable need for local services, and steady population growth promises long-term business sustainability. The market is well-established, offering companies operational stability and opportunities for partnerships and client acquisition, thanks to a robust mix of corporate, public sector, and professional firms.

London

Choosing a virtual office address in London will provide your business with a prestigious presence in the city, without the hefty overheads of establishing a physical office space. Your business will gain significant advantages from being associated with a powerful economic hub, contributing £307 billion to the national economy and £109 billion to the local economy each year.

With 678,000 professionals in the City of London, and 1 in 48 workers in Great Britain, a virtual office there will connect you to many potential clients and partners. The area's 25% job growth since 2019, along with its internationally diverse and highly skilled workforce, significantly amplifies the brand's credibility and opens doors to unparalleled new business opportunities.
